Summary: Ramprasad (Amol Palekar) is a recent college graduate who finds a job with Bhavani Shankar (Utpal Dutt), who believes that a man without a mustache is a man without a character. When Ramprasad is caught by his boss at a soccer match, he has to invent a twin brother, the clean-shaven Laxman Prasad, to save his job. When Bhavani's daughter falls in love with the clean-shaven Laxman Prasad, and insists on marrying him, and Bhavani insists she should marry Ramprasad, things take a whacky turn. (imdb)
AKA: Golmaal
AKA: Hotch-Potch
Country: India

One of my all-time favorite comedy movies. While anything from Hrishikesh Mukherjee is a treat for the soul, this movie in particular is pure solid gold, only fully appreciated with a good knowledge of the Hindi language - subtitles doesn't do this movie any justice. The humor in this movie is class, with Utpal Dutt delivering perhaps the performance of his life-time.
